Shower Stall Installation in Stamford, CT
Shower stall installation services involve the setup and replacement of shower enclosures within residential bathrooms. These projects typically include installing new shower stalls, upgrading existing units, or customizing designs to match a home's aesthetic. Homeowners often seek this service when renovating a bathroom, replacing outdated or damaged units, or updating fixtures to improve functionality and style. Before requesting installation, property owners usually want to understand the types of shower stalls available, the materials used, and the overall process involved in fitting the new enclosure securely and efficiently.
Property owners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the bathroom, the preferred style of shower stall, and any specific features like glass doors or built-in shelving. It’s also helpful to clarify what preparation work might be needed beforehand, such as removing old units or ensuring plumbing connections are compatible. Understanding these details can help ensure the installation process goes smoothly and results in a durable, attractive shower area that meets both practical needs and personal preferences.

Shower Stall Installation Questions
What types of shower stalls can be installed? A variety of shower stall styles are available, including framed, frameless, corner, and walk-in designs to suit different bathroom layouts and preferences.
Is it possible to upgrade an existing shower stall? Yes, existing shower stalls can often be replaced or upgraded to improve functionality and appearance, with options for new materials and features.
What materials are commonly used for shower stall installation? Common materials include glass, acrylic, fiberglass, and tile, each offering different durability and aesthetic qualities.
What should property owners consider before installing a new shower stall? Factors such as space dimensions, plumbing configuration, and style preferences are important to ensure a proper fit and long-lasting installation.
